From: Philip Kaludercic Date: Wed, 12 Oct 2022 19:21:38 +0000 (+0200) Subject: * lisp/emacs-lisp/package-vc.el (package-vc-refresh): Add function. X-Git-Tag: emacs-29.0.90~1616^2~307^2~61 X-Git-Url: http://git.eshelyaron.com/gitweb/?a=commitdiff_plain;h=0e3b67e3a37c01b71e6b97cd9b16ee28452a9f72;p=emacs.git * lisp/emacs-lisp/package-vc.el (package-vc-refresh): Add function. --- diff --git a/lisp/emacs-lisp/package-vc.el b/lisp/emacs-lisp/package-vc.el index 1ce43044d46..d513e9a7331 100644 --- a/lisp/emacs-lisp/package-vc.el +++ b/lisp/emacs-lisp/package-vc.el @@ -353,6 +353,11 @@ be requested using REV." :kind 'vc) pkg-dir))) +(defun package-vc-refresh (pkg-desc) + "Refresh the installation for PKG-DESC." + (interactive (package-vc-read-pkg "Refresh package: ")) + (package-vc-unpack-1 pkg-desc (package-desc-dir pkg-desc))) + (defun package-vc-read-pkg (prompt) "Query for a source package description with PROMPT." (cadr (assoc (completing-read